This may not work for you and it may make little difference now, but you may be able to verify that BB did or did not actually try to authorize your account.  If it truely was rejected, you may even be able to find out why it was rejected.  Try by calling the 800 number on your credit card statement and explain the info you need from them.  You want to verify authorization attempts on your account for a certain time period, and the results of those authorizations.

The company I work for processes credit card authorizations and settlements....I often talk to the authorizing bank to determine very specific information about specific requests, mostly to figure out why a request was rejected.  Believe me, they keep good details about every transaction that comes in and out.  The difference might be that I talk to the authorizing bank, while you need to start with the issuing bank...but I'm pretty sure the issuing bank has the same records since they are the ones who would have denied your card.

I've never done this from a customer standpoint but I hope you can get the results you need.
